Collectors in Brownsburg find value in rookie cards of Hall of Fame athletes spanning baseball, basketball, football, and hockey. PSA graded rookie inserts, limited edition cards, and autographed specimens tend to generate particular enthusiasm within the community.
Evaluations depend heavily on the card’s condition, verified through grading companies like PSA and Beckett. Rarity, print runs, and player prominence influence worth, while recent market activity and collector interest keep values fluid.
